Is 8 157 336 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 8 157 336 is about 2 856.105.

Thus, the square root of 8 157 336 is not an integer, and therefore 8 157 336 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 8 157 336?

The square of a number (here 8 157 336) is the result of the product of this number (8 157 336) by itself (i.e., 8 157 336 × 8 157 336); the square of 8 157 336 is sometimes called "raising 8 157 336 to the power 2", or "8 157 336 squared".

The square of 8 157 336 is 66 542 130 616 896 because 8 157 336 × 8 157 336 = 8 157 3362 = 66 542 130 616 896.

As a consequence, 8 157 336 is the square root of 66 542 130 616 896.
